EATON XT Series IEC Mini Contactors

Eaton XT-Series mini contactors are compact relay units that switch on / off an electric circuit. These full voltage non-reversing units are useful in compact machines, conveyors and PCB boards where saving space is a major concern.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the difference between AC and DC contactors?

DC contactor has a maximum operating frequency of 1200 times per hour, while AC contactors have a maximum operating frequency of 600 times per hour.

What is the full voltage non-reversing method?

When the controller's single contactor actuates, FVNR allows the full line voltage to be applied to the motor. With an FVNR motor controller, the position of the line phases is fixed and the motor can only be operated in one rotational direction.

What is the difference between a relay and a contactor?

Relays control contacts of an electrical circuit due to a change of parameters or conditions in the same circuit or any other associated circuit. Contactors, on the other hand, are used to interrupt or establish connections in an electrical circuit repeatedly under different conditions.
